It's not just Avira with that issue. I had it with Avast on Vista but a recent update appears to have fixed it. Avira's research showed that many AV vendors, and other vendors, have the problem on Vista/Win 7 but it doesn't show up for everyone and for many only the precursor Event 5038 in Security Audit appears and the actual chkdsk on reboot does not happen or doesn't for a long time. Yet, for a few, one Event 5038 immediately led to chkdsk on boot. Strange problem in that it doesn't manifest, in full degree, on all computers with these AV (and some other programs) using Vista/Win 7.
